Revision 1834 trunk/client/gui/Makefile.am

Makefile.am (revision 1834)
1 1
## Process this file with automake to produce Makefile.in
2 2
include $(top_srcdir)/Makefile.decl
3 3

                
4
INCLUDES = $(GLIB_CFLAGS) $(GTK3_CFLAGS) $(GTK_CFLAGS) $(GLADE_CFLAGS) $(CURL_CFLAGS) $(LIBXML2_CFLAGS) $(SOUP_CFLAGS) $(SOUP_GNOME_CFLAGS) -I$(top_srcdir)/base -I$(top_srcdir)/nntpgrab_core -I$(top_srcdir)/glue -I$(top_srcdir)/gui_base -I$(top_srcdir)/automation -DNNTPGRABLOCALEDIR=\""$(nntpgrablocaledir)"\"
4
INCLUDES = $(GLIB_CFLAGS) $(GTK3_CFLAGS) $(GTK_CFLAGS) $(GLADE_CFLAGS) $(CURL_CFLAGS) $(LIBXML2_CFLAGS) $(SOUP_CFLAGS) $(SOUP_GNOME_CFLAGS) $(DBUS_CFLAGS) $(LIBNOTIFY_CFLAGS) -I$(top_srcdir)/base -I$(top_srcdir)/nntpgrab_core -I$(top_srcdir)/glue -I$(top_srcdir)/gui_base -I$(top_srcdir)/automation -DNNTPGRABLOCALEDIR=\""$(nntpgrablocaledir)"\"
5 5

                
6 6
AM_CFLAGS = -Wall -g
7 7

                
... ...
20 20
nntpgrab_gui_debug_LDFLAGS = -mconsole
21 21
endif
22 22

                
23
nntpgrab_gui_LDADD = $(top_srcdir)/base/libnntpgrab_utils.la $(top_srcdir)/glue/libnntpgrab_glue.la $(top_srcdir)/gui_base/libnntpgrab_gui_base.la $(top_srcdir)/automation/libnntpgrab_automation.la $(GLIB_LIBS) $(GTK3_LIBS) $(GTK_LIBS) $(GLADE_LIBS) $(CURL_LIBS) $(LIBXML2_LIBS) $(SOUP_LIBS) $(SOUP_GNOME_LIBS)
23
nntpgrab_gui_LDADD = $(top_srcdir)/base/libnntpgrab_utils.la $(top_srcdir)/glue/libnntpgrab_glue.la $(top_srcdir)/gui_base/libnntpgrab_gui_base.la $(top_srcdir)/automation/libnntpgrab_automation.la $(GLIB_LIBS) $(GTK3_LIBS) $(GTK_LIBS) $(GLADE_LIBS) $(CURL_LIBS) $(LIBXML2_LIBS) $(SOUP_LIBS) $(SOUP_GNOME_LIBS) $(DBUS_LIBS) $(LIBNOTIFY_LIBS)
24 24

                
25
if HAVE_LIBNOTIFY
26
nntpgrab_gui_CFLAGS += -DHAVE_LIBNOTIFY $(LIBNOTIFY_CFLAGS)
27
nntpgrab_gui_LDADD += $(LIBNOTIFY_LIBS)
28
endif
29

                
30
if HAVE_LIBNOTIFY_0_7
31
nntpgrab_gui_CFLAGS += -DHAVE_LIBNOTIFY_0_7
32
endif
33

                
34
if HAVE_SOUP
35
nntpgrab_gui_CFLAGS += -DHAVE_SOUP
36
endif
37

                
38
if HAVE_SOUP_GNOME
39
nntpgrab_gui_CFLAGS += -DHAVE_SOUP_GNOME
40
endif
41

                
42
if HAVE_SOUP_GZIP
43
nntpgrab_gui_CFLAGS += -DHAVE_SOUP_GZIP
44
endif
45

                
46 25
EXTRA_DIST += \
47 26
       nntpgrab_gui.glade \
48 27
       nntpgrab_gui.ui \
... ...
118 97

                
119 98
nntpgrab_gui_dbus_glue.h: nntpgrab_gui_dbus.xml
120 99
       $(LIBTOOL) --mode=execute dbus-binding-tool --prefix=nntpgrab_dbus --mode=glib-server --output=nntpgrab_gui_dbus_glue.h $(srcdir)/nntpgrab_gui_dbus.xml
121
nntpgrab_gui_CFLAGS += -DHAVE_DBUS $(DBUS_CFLAGS)
122
nntpgrab_gui_LDADD += $(DBUS_LIBS)
123 100
endif
124 101

                
125 102
nntpgrab_gui_SOURCES += ipc_linux.c

Also available in: Unified diff